Gremio’s Danish striker Martin Braithwaite is exploring the possibility of buying his former club Espanyol. Gremio striker Martin Braithwaite has told Spanish online publication La Grada on Thursday. He has hired a leading Spanish law firm to oversee negotiations over the purchase of his former football club Espanyol.

The 33-year-old striker was also seen in the stands of the RCD Stadium to watch Espanyol take on Valencia on Wednesday. Before Braithwaite revealed to the media that. He is in the process of looking to buy the Parrots and is looking for investors to join as partners to help the deal go through.

Braithwaite still has a home in the Catalan capital and a business there. The Danish forward’s assets are estimated at around €300m and could easily buy Espanyol. If he can find a business partner, with Chinese chairman Chen Yan looking to sell the Parrots.

He had previously asked about buying Espanyol and said in May: “It is not the time to talk about these things. First we have to go up directly and then we will see what happens with the club.”

Marca now claim that he indeed does intend to become the majority shareholder at Espanyol. Displacing current owner and chairman Chen Yansheng.
